Larry-G
28-08-13, 22:56
ok try this.

via a telnet session issue the init 4 command to kill enigma.

now FTP into the receiver to /var/lib/opkg/lists and delete the files in there.

back to telnet issue the opkg update && init 3 command and when it reboots try the feeds again.
